Emily was so happy she had taken a jacket with her for the walk. The mountain air was so cool at times, even though it was a lovely hot summer day. After following a difficult path for several grueling miles she got to an opening where she could stand and bathe in the sunshine. Looking at the mountains and isolated clouds in the blue sky, she thought about how wonderful it was walking in the outdoors and enjoying the open air instead of being stuck in a hospital room and physiotherapy gyms.
Relaxing on a nearby rock she began to reflect on how she had felt so frightened and shattered like a bloody prisoner for way too long. It still angered and frustrated her how she had at least believed in her own heart that nobody else really believed her about being mysteriously thrust into another version of America. She could still remember those loud Atlantic waves hitting that island she was stuck on. She damn well knew that she was really there! It wasn't some kind of dream she had during her surgery. If the police didn't really want to accept that she really experienced it then she was done with it all! It was at that moment when she suddenly decided she wasn't going to make her way back to that Homeland Security compound. Instead she was going to try to get back to her job in suburban Boston. She really didn't care how impossible it felt then.
After all, the main doctor there had said that morning,
"You're back to full health, Ms. Brisk!
Good to go!
You should consider going outside and taking a nice long walk,"
Emily obviously knew that Doctor wasn't expecting her to find an exit off the heavily guarded compound and discover this path cut through seemingly unpassable mountains. She was fed up with the F.B.I. and Homeland Security. She obviously still loved her sister Nancy. She really appreciated the protection. It just was feeling endless. She wanted to go on with her own life.
Just beyond that opening Emily found a fork with two paths, She took the less used path and she almost regretted her choice as after mile or two of climbing the path suddenly took her too sharply down a slope, She almost lost her balance and hit a tree. As she caught her bearings she noticed a nearby dirt road several yards below. She would spend about two hours carefully climbing down to that road. She decided to walk on the road going east. It was so nice and easy to walk on a road vehicles could travel.
After walking on the road for about ten miles Emily was getting tired and thirsty. A mile later the road turned sharply to the left to reveal some old cottages. She could see a paved road behind the cottages which looked like a local highway.
Out of water and requiring a bathroom, Emily nervously decided to knock on the door of the cottage that had a small Volkswagen parked in front. A very tall red haired woman in her late twenties eventually answered the door. With a very surprised look on her face she asked,
"Where in God's earth did you come from?!"
The lady's name was Abigale Cinderbrook and she was spending part of her last day in America in her parents' cottage. A recent Medical graduate, Abigale was ignoring dozens of lucrative job offers and heading to Sudan to work with Doctors Without Borders. As she took care of Emily, she kept going on about how the world just ignores the crisis in Sudan. They got along famously as Abigale gave Emily fluids and set her up in a cool arm chair her father used to vegetate in.
Abigale had actually heard about that Home Land Security place in the mountains. She wasn't too keen about calling anybody about Emily. She had a flight to catch to Doha at 7pm from Logan airport. She was more than happy to give Emily a ride into Boston. Borrowing Abigale's cell phone, Emily called her boss, Mylene Sears at work. Mylene was extremely happy to hear from Emily and the fact that Emily wanted to return to work tomorrow. Mylene had John Anderson the head of security talk to Emily.
At a Duncan Donuts on Bennington Street in Boston, Abigale parked her car and hugged Emily goodbye. Emily really thought that Abigale was some kind of angel doing what she was doing in terms of travelling thousands of miles into a dangerous situation to help people in dire need. Emily had found herself in dangerous situations. She wished her the best of luck.
After Abigale left for the airport, Emily sat and ate a donut. Twenty minutes later Mr. Anderson arrived and to say that "they were both were pleased and excited to see each other" would be an understatement. Mr. Anderson was tall and mighty man with extremely good looks. Emily had always liked him.
Unable to openly speak in public they sat in Mr. Anderson's company Cadillac to do so. Mr. Anderson didn't like the way that the F.B,I. and Homeland Security had basically hid Emily away. When Emily warned him that she could be considered an escapee from Homeland Security he smiled and said "Don't worry about those idiots."
Evidently Mrs. Sears had attempted to obtain information about Emily's status to no avail. Both the F.B.I. and Homeland Security were not taken too well by the company. Mr. Anderson had orders to secure Emily in one of the company's guest houses. Transportation to and from the company would be provided with strict security. Nobody was going to know where she was going to live.
"It will be our secret. Fuck the government,"
Before getting shot in New York, the project Emily was spearheading was considered to be practically a game changer for humanity. Now she could concentrate on it. As Mr. Anderson drove her to the guest house, Emily beamed with a positivity she had not encountered for a disturbing bout. She thought how maybe the nightmare was finally over!
